How do I permanently change time zones in Windows 10?

In Date & time, you can choose to let Windows 10 set your time and time zone automatically, or you can set them manually. To set your time and time zone in Windows 10, go to Start > Settings > Time & language > Date & time.

How to set time zone using Control Panel

  1. Open Control Panel.
  2. Click on Clock, Language, and Region. Click the Change the time zone link.
  3. Click the Change time zone button. Time zone settings in Control Panel.
  4. Select the appropriate time for your location.
  5. Click the OK button.
  6. Click the Apply button.
  7. Click the OK button.

How do I fix the wrong time zone on Windows 10?

Press the Windows + R keys and type Control, click Clock, Language and Region and click Date and Time. Click the Date and Time tab. Click Change time zone. Make sure the correct time zone is selected.

Why does my time zone keep changing Windows 10?

The clock in your Windows computer can be configured to sync with an Internet time server, which can be useful as it ensures your clock stays accurate. In cases where your date or time keeps changing from what you’ve previously set it to, it is likely that your computer is syncing with a time server.

Why won’t my computer let me change the date and time?

To get started, right-click the clock on the taskbar and then click on the Adjust date/time setting on the menu. Then turn off the options to set the time and time zone automatically. If these are enabled, the option to change the date, time, and time zone will be grayed out.

How do I sync my clock in Windows 10?

Method 2:

  1. a. Click on clock and select “Change date and time settings”.
  2. b. Click on the “Internet Time” tab.
  3. c. Check if it is set to “synchronize the time with time.windows.com”
  4. d. If the option is selected, click on change settings to check the option “Synchronize with an Internet Time server”
  5. e. Click on OK.

Why does my computer default to the wrong time zone?

An Incorrect Time Zone Setting



When your computer clock is off by exactly one or more hours, Windows may simply be set to the wrong time zone. Even if you fix the time manually, Windows will reset itself to the wrong time zone once you reboot. … You can also go to Settings > Time & Language > Date & time.
